BACKGROUND
Technical Field

The present invention relates to a technical field of storage device testing, and in particular, to a power control device and a power test system.


Description of Related Art

Most storage devices undergo power-down testing during the development stage to ensure that the storage device has sufficient stability during use by users. However, in actual scenarios, the power-supply methods for different types of storage devices may be different. When power-down testing of different types of storage devices is required, additional power-supply equipment, connecting cables and interface circuits of different specifications need to be used to meet the power-supply requirements of different types of storage devices. However, such a test environment is not conducive to large-scale testing of a large number of storage devices that may be of different types, and its power-down test efficiency is low.

In the field of semiconductor storage, in order to consider the functional completeness of the storage device, it is necessary to conduct relevant verification on the power-supply test of the storage device during the development stage of the storage device, which mainly includes power-down test of the storage device. Power-down of a storage device describes a situation in which a storage device cannot work normally due to power off, loss of power, or power quality that does not meet the requirements. For storage media such as Nand Flash, power-down of the carrier storage device of storage media directly affects the performance of storing data, thus the power-down test is greatly meaningful to the storage device. However, in actual applications, there are several different power-down test manners for the same storage device, and power-down tests for different types of storage devices are quite complicated to implement.

S10: Obtaining at least one power-supply path manner of at least one power-down test device.


In one embodiment, this application uses Nand Flash storage media as an example to describe the power-down test of the storage device. First of all, this application records storage devices that use Nand Flash as storage media, such as different types of SSD (Solid State Disk, solid state drive), pen drives and other related storage devices. Then, these storage devices can be classified according to the implementation manners of storage medium, such as SSD being divided into one group, and pen drive being divided into another group. Furthermore, storage devices in the same group can be further classified according to models and so on, so as to determine the storage devices to be tested (i.e., power-down test device).


Understandably, in practical applications, facing so many kinds of power-down test devices, it is very difficult to achieve a fast, comprehensive and accurate power-down test. Testers often need to re-establish different test paths to meet the power-down tests for multiple power-down test devices. This method is complex and error-prone, and is lack of power-down test efficiency.


In this application, firstly, the power-supply path manner of the power-down test device is obtained, to perform uniformly management and deployment on power-down test devices based on the power-supply path manner. It is understandable that, for example, for a pen drive, its power-supply path manner may include power input, USB (Universal Serial Bus) input, etc. The power-supply path manner of the USB input can include an input manner that only implements the charging function, and another input manner that implements both the charging function and the data transmission function. For SSD, similar to a pen drive, in addition to the above power-supply path manner, it further includes power-supply path manner corresponding to different protocol interfaces. In this application, for such a large number and complex power-supply path manners, the power-supply path manners used by the power-down test devices are summarized, so as to perform fast and accurate power-down tests on different storage devices based on these power-supply path manners.


S20: Determining at least one power-supply path interface according to the at least one of power-supply path manner.


In one embodiment, these power-supply path manners are integrated and implemented on different power-supply path interfaces in this application. One or more power-supply path manners can correspond to a power-supply path interface, for example, the power input interface corresponds to the power-supply path manner of power input. The power-supply path manner of USB input can be used such as a hub integrated into a USB input interface. Two input manners used only for charging and both for charging and data transmission in power-supply path manners of USB can also be integrated into the USB input interface. This can effectively reduce the number of power-supply path interfaces and facilitate the integration of power-supply path interface for power-down test.


In one embodiment, this application uses a limited number of power-supply path interfaces to provide a basis for establishing test paths for different power-down test devices to perform power-down tests. Under a system based on this power-supply path, when performing power-down test, the power test system can always find the appropriate power-supply path interface and support the rapid establishment of the corresponding test path. The determination of at least one power-supply path interface is an important technical implementation basis for implementing the power test system and the implement of arrangement of unity power-down tests for different storage devices.


S30: Determining at least one electronic switch according to the at least one power-supply path interface, wherein the electronic switch is used to control changes in electric energy.


In an embodiment, the electronic switch may have multiple forms of expression. Specifically, the electronic switch may refer to a MOSFET (Metal-Oxide-Semiconductor Field-Effect Transistor), or it may also be an electronic component such as a signal relay. Among them, the function of the electronic switch is to realize change control of input electric energy. The input electric energy can be output after processing with certain changes, for example, to control the changes of voltage value such as boosting and reducing voltage. Among them, for the power-supply path interface that mainly provides power-supply function, the corresponding MOSFET can be specifically set to control the input voltage value through the MOSFET to achieve the control effect of the power-down function; for communication-based power-supply path interface, the corresponding signal relay can be specifically set to ensure that the signal is not distorted.


In one embodiment, one power-supply path interface can correspond to one electronic switch, and multiple power-supply path interfaces can correspond to one or more electronic switches. Among them, one possible implementation way is to set one corresponding electronic switch for each power-supply path interface. The electronic switch is specially used to control the power conversion of the corresponding power-supply path interface to achieve various functions of power-down test.


Furthermore, in this application, one electronic switch can also corresponds to multiple power-supply path interfaces. In this case, the controller (MCU, Micro Controller Unit) needs to be set accordingly. Specifically, when the power-down test switches between different power-supply path interfaces, the same electronic switch can be associate with different power-supply path interfaces in different time periods, and according to the specific associated power-supply path interface, the controller can issue corresponding power change control instructions to the electronic switch, so that the electronic switch can accurately perform the power-down test on the storage device in the current scenario. Understandably, in a manner of one electronic switch corresponding to different power-supply path interfaces, the electronic switch needs to be configured with circuit configuration conditions that can simultaneously satisfy different power change control schemes. In a manner of one electronic switch corresponding to one power-supply path interface, the circuit configuration conditions of the electronic switch can be reduced. Furthermore, in a manner of one electronic switch corresponding to one power-supply path interface, each power-supply path interface can choose to select an electronic switch from multiple electronic switches to establish an association. In other words, one electronic switch and one power-supply path interface is no longer the only binding relationship, the relationship between the electronic switch and the power-supply path interface can be flexibly changed. For this kind of design, in this application, synchronous testing of multiple power-down test devices can be realized. Even if the same power-supply path interface is used for power-down test, through associating different electronic switches to implement the synchronous testing of multiple power-down test devices, the idle electronic switch can be effectively used and the power-down test efficiency can be significantly improved.


S40: Determining at least one target device to be tested.


In one embodiment, during the formal testing phase, one or more target devices actually used for power-down testing can be selected from storage devices that are possibly be used in the power-down testing. It should be noted that, the target device can generally be set to the same group of storage devices. For example, multiple SSD devices can be grouped in the same group for testing, and pen drives can be grouped to another group for testing. Of course, the solution in this application can support the power-down testing for at least two types of the storage devices, and there are no restrictions on specific test objects.

FIG. 2 is a functional block diagram of a power test system according to an embodiment of the present application. As shown in FIG. 2, the power test system may specifically include multiple interfaces of power-supply path interface 1-n, a controller 21, a power conversion module 22, a restart module 23 and an output module 24. Among them, the various power-supply path interfaces 1-n and the power conversion module 22 can be used to establish the target power-supply path and build the test environment/channel required for the power-down test of the target device. The controller 21 can receive instructions from a host computer and generate instructions with a variety of different functions, so as to achieve accurate power-down testing of the target device through the controller 21. Among them, the restart module 23 is a module that implements the power restart function after power-down during the power-down test process, and can restart the target device after power-down to restore the target device to the original state; the output module 24 may include multiple output ports, and the output ports may be connected to one or more target devices, thereby enabling power-down testing of different storage devices. Among them, it should be noted that, the component modules in the power test system can be equipped with corresponding memories and processors to implement communication and interaction between different modules and enabling of specific functions through storing the instructions in the memories, and the processor can implement the above power-down test steps according to the instructions stored in the memories.



FIG. 3 is another functional block diagram of a power test system according to an embodiment of the present application. As shown in FIG. 3, the main difference between FIG. 3 and FIG. 2 is that, the power conversion module 22 can specifically include multiple electronic switches 31, and the output module 24 includes multiple output ports such as output ports 1-n; in addition, the power-supply paths in the power test system of FIG. 3 corresponds to the electronic switches 31 one-by-one; in addition, electronic switches 31 and output ports 1-n can also be set to be corresponding to each other one-by-one. The manner shown in FIG. 3 can facilitate the management of the power-supply path interface. During the power-down test, the system does not need to determine how to select the power-supply path interface and the electronic switch, but only needs to establish the target power-supply path based on the unique mapping relationship.


Furthermore, on the basis of FIG. 3, the electronic switches 31 and the output ports 1-n may not be set to be corresponding to each other one-by-one. In this case, when establishing the target power-supply path, the power test system may select an appropriate electronic switch 31 based on the power-supply path interface 1-n. This manner is relatively low in implementation cost, and the system flexibility and maintainability are relatively high, and it supports replacement for failed electronic components.



FIG. 4 is another functional block diagram of a power test system according to an embodiment of the present application. As shown in FIG. 4, the main difference between FIG. 4 and FIG. 2 is that, the power conversion module 22 is specifically provided with only one electronic switch 41, and the output module 24 includes multiple output ports such as output ports 1-n. This manner has higher requirements on the ability of the electronic switch 41 to control changes in electric energy, but at the same time, any power-supply path interface can establish the target power-supply path required for testing through the electronic switch 41.


Furthermore, on the basis of FIG. 4, multiple electronic switches 41 with strong ability to control electric energy changes can also be set up as shown in FIG. 4. In this way, multiple target power-supply paths can be established at the same time to achieve the power-down tests for multiple target devices within the same time period. Moreover, in this manner, the system does not need to determine how to select power-supply path interface 1-n and electronic switches 41 during power-down test.



FIG. 5 is another functional block diagram of a power test system according to an embodiment of the present application. As shown in FIG. 5, the main difference between FIG. 5 and FIG. 2 is that, multiple power-supply path interfaces 1-n in FIG. 5 can support collective encapsulation, such as the collective power-supply path interface 1 in FIG. 5; for example, the interface that implements the power-supply function of a pen drive and the interface that implements power-supply and communication can be integrated using a hub, which can simplify the complexity of the power-supply path interface in this system.
